With a voice frequently compared to Joni Mitchell’s, Nancy Jephcote is gearing up for the release of a solo album this fall — but you can hear the Vineyard singer, songwriter and award-winning fiddler at a concert at 8 p.m. tonight, Friday, August 15, at Katharine Cornell Theatre in Vineyard Haven.

Well known for her work with the Flying Elbows fiddle band, songwriting has long been another side of this versatile performer’s offerings. Paul Thurlow and Brian Weiland will add instrumentals and vocal harmonies.

The new disc is entitled Garland of Rain and has been produced by Tom Prasada-Rao in Dallas, Tex., over the past year. Examples of Ms. Jephcote’s songwriting also can be heard on the Vineyard Sound albums, available online and at Simon Gallery in Vineyard Haven.

The theatre is located above the town hall at 51 Spring street in Vineyard Haven. Admission is $10 at the door.
